Publisher's summary

Intuitive Eating is the go-to book on rebuilding a healthy body image and making peace with food. We’ve all been there—angry with ourselves for overeating, for our lack of willpower, for failing at yet another diet. But the problem isn’t us; it’s that dieting, with its strict rules, keeps us from listening to our bodies. Written by two prominent nutritionists, Intuitive Eating will teach you how to reject diet mentality forever; how our three eating "personalities" define our eating difficulties; how to find satisfaction in your eating; how to feel your feelings without using food; how to honor hunger and feel fullness; how to follow the 10 principles of "intuitive eating"; how to achieve a new and safe relationship with food and, ultimately, your body; and more.

This revised edition includes updates and expansions throughout, as well as two brand-new chapters that will help listeners integrate intuitive eating even more fully into their daily lives.

The narrator's tone is scolding!

I really like the book, the topic, and all the ways that it is relevant in each one of our everyday lives. However, the narrator sounded like she was lecturing the entire time which was really kind of the opposite of what I thought the book was trying to portray in terms of tone. When learning how to adopt a flexible and intuitive eating mindset, rules and restrictions no longer exist, however this lady made it sound like she was scolding me the entire time she read the book.

Excellent information, however....

I enjoyed the information. in the beginning, I felt I was listening to my biography! It is useful information and has helped me see where I need improvement. HOWEVER, the only drawback is the repetitiveness. I understand this is a teaching method, but there were times I literally thought I had gone back to a previous chapter because I was hearing identical information. Overall, a good resource, but be patient.
